Turkey’s January scrap imports decrease, billet intake rises
Turkish scrap imports declined -17.2% year-on-year to 1.14 million tonnes in January, while billet imports climbed up. The average scrap import price went down by $121/tonne to $197/t cfr Turkey, Kallanish calculates from the latest Turkish Statistical Institute (TUIK) data.
The fall in scrap imports comes after a growth by 34.9% y-o-y in the previous month to 1.74mt with an average value of $193/t.
